Win32_PointingDevice: Sorting Pointing Devices (WQL has no ORDER BY)

WQL has no ORDER BY clause — this shows the standard workaround of piping Get-CimInstance results through Sort-Object on Win32_PointingDevice.

PointingDeviceSorted.ps1
<#
.SYNOPSIS
    WQL reference: sorting Pointing Devices results (Win32_PointingDevice).

.DESCRIPTION
    WQL (the WMI Query Language) does not support an ORDER BY clause —
    unlike regular SQL. Sort after the fact with Sort-Object instead;
    this is one of the most common WQL gotchas for people coming from
    SQL backgrounds.

.EXAMPLE
    .\PointingDeviceSorted.ps1
#>

[CmdletBinding()]
param()

$wqlQuery = "SELECT Name, Manufacturer, NumberOfButtons FROM Win32_PointingDevice"

Get-CimInstance -Query $wqlQuery |
    Sort-Object -Property Name |
    Format-Table -Property Name, Manufacturer, NumberOfButtons -AutoSize
